Transaction 82a113e601ea9703c539a37b99ed174b32c959c57c110b1bc9ca97ffd20662f6

1 Input
2 Outputs
  • 82a113e601ea9703c539a37b99ed174b32c959c57c110b1bc9ca97ffd20662f6:0
  • value  1119016
    address  35QfoYRSvye4Ud9Luttnh2XHv2cEhDu1BQ
  • 82a113e601ea9703c539a37b99ed174b32c959c57c110b1bc9ca97ffd20662f6:1
  • value  23558328
    address  378kAjMuVgU26yKGaFCU24EETEaVprjJ2H